GfK Top 10 All Format Full Priced Games Week Ending 22nd July

The latest GfK sales charts are out, and for the second week running, there’s not a single PlayStation 3 or Xbox 360 title in the top ten. Here’s a hint publishers, if you want your games to sell, try pricing them a little closer to their US counterparts. It’s pretty clearly working for Nintendo! Gamers in the US would have a conniption fit if games cost US$88-97 - and that’s standard affair for new Xbox 360 and PlayStation 3 titles in Australia.

eBayed PS2 arrives with 65,400 Euros

Wednesday, July 18th, 2007

Sixty five thousand fooooooooooooooooooooour hundred!

The BBC is reporting one of the strangest eBay stories you’ll ever hear, regarding a 16-year-old boy from Norfolk who recently bought a PlayStation 2 from the online auction site.

When it arrived without two of the games mentioned in the auction, he was a little disappointed…until he noticed the fat wad of notes in the box, totalling 65,400 Euros (US$90,120). No doubt creating a scene that would make the Nintendo 64 Kid look sensible, the parents cottoned on and have contacted authorities who are now looking after the loot. There is a chance the money could be reclaimed should the matter remain unsolved.
